The Virtual Medical Staff: A Comprehensive Guide
The rise of telehealth and remote work has spurred the development of the virtual medical staff – a rapidly evolving model for healthcare organizations seeking to enhance productivity and reduce costs. This guide examines what a virtual medical staff entails , including the roles they perform, the perks they offer, and the obstacles involved in establishing one. A typical virtual medical staff might include remote medical assistants, financial specialists, customer service representatives, and even virtual scribes, all working from a secure and compliant environment.
- Administrative Support: Scheduling appointments, managing files, and handling communications .
- Billing & Revenue Cycle Management: Processing claims , resolving issues, and ensuring accurate coding.
- Patient Communication: Answering questions , providing information , and offering assistance .

Healthcare Staffing Solutions: Challenges & Opportunities
The present healthcare sector faces considerable difficulties regarding staffing solutions. Escalating patient demand coupled with frequent nurse shortages and burnout amongst veteran clinicians creates a intricate situation. Nevertheless , opportunities are present for forward-thinking staffing agencies to address these concerns. These kinds of opportunities involve the implementation of flexible staffing approaches, leveraging technology for talent acquisition, and prioritizing on team member retention strategies to establish a reliable and positive healthcare workforce.
